Who is an Operator?

An operator is a skilled professional responsible for managing and controlling machinery, equipment, or processes in various industries. In India, operators are crucial in manufacturing, construction, energy, and transportation sectors. They ensure that equipment runs efficiently, safely, and according to established procedures. Operators often work in teams and must possess strong technical skills, attention to detail, and the ability to troubleshoot problems quickly.

  • Key Responsibilities:

    • Operating and monitoring equipment
    • Performing routine maintenance
    • Troubleshooting malfunctions
    • Ensuring safety protocols are followed
    • Maintaining accurate records
  • Essential Skills:

    • Technical proficiency
    • Problem-solving abilities
    • Attention to detail
    • Communication skills
    • Safety consciousness

In India, the demand for skilled operators is consistently high due to the country's growing industrial sector. Opportunities exist in both public and private organizations, offering stable career paths and potential for advancement.

What Does an Operator Do?

The role of an operator is multifaceted, involving a range of tasks critical to the smooth functioning of industrial operations. In India, operators are essential in sectors like manufacturing, oil and gas, and infrastructure development. Their responsibilities extend beyond simply running machinery; they are also involved in maintenance, quality control, and safety management.

  • Core Functions:

    • Equipment Operation: Operating machinery and equipment according to standard operating procedures.
    • Monitoring Performance: Continuously monitoring equipment performance to identify potential issues.
    • Maintenance: Performing routine maintenance tasks, such as cleaning, lubricating, and inspecting equipment.
    • Troubleshooting: Diagnosing and resolving equipment malfunctions or process deviations.
    • Safety Compliance: Adhering to strict safety protocols and ensuring a safe working environment.
    • Record Keeping: Maintaining accurate records of equipment operation, maintenance activities, and any incidents.
  • Specific Examples:

    • Machine Operators: Control and monitor production machinery in manufacturing plants.
    • Crane Operators: Operate cranes to lift and move heavy materials on construction sites.
    • Plant Operators: Manage and control equipment in power plants or chemical processing facilities.

In the Indian context, operators often work in challenging environments, requiring adaptability and a strong commitment to safety.

How to Become an Operator in India?

Becoming an operator in India typically involves a combination of education, training, and practical experience. Several pathways can lead to a career as an operator, depending on the specific industry and type of equipment involved.

  • Educational Qualifications:

    • ITI Diploma: An Industrial Training Institute (ITI) diploma in a relevant trade (e.g., fitter, machinist, electrician) is a common starting point.
    • Diploma in Engineering: A diploma in mechanical, electrical, or chemical engineering can provide a more comprehensive foundation.
    • Bachelor's Degree: A bachelor's degree in engineering is often preferred for more advanced operator roles.
  • Training and Certification:

    • Apprenticeships: Many companies offer apprenticeships that combine on-the-job training with classroom instruction.
    • Vocational Training: Specialized vocational training programs focus on specific types of equipment or processes.
    • Certification: Obtaining relevant certifications can enhance job prospects and demonstrate competence.
  • Key Steps:

    1. Complete relevant education or training.
    2. Gain practical experience through internships or entry-level positions.
    3. Develop technical skills and knowledge of equipment operation.
    4. Obtain necessary certifications.
    5. Continuously update skills and knowledge to stay current with industry advancements.

In India, government initiatives like the Skill India Mission are promoting vocational training and skill development, making it easier for aspiring operators to acquire the necessary skills.

History and Evolution of Operator Roles

The role of an operator has evolved significantly over time, mirroring advancements in technology and industrial processes. Historically, operators were primarily responsible for manual control and monitoring of simple machinery. However, with the advent of automation and computerization, their roles have become more complex and demanding.

  • Early Stages:

    • Operators were primarily involved in manual tasks, such as starting and stopping machines, adjusting settings, and performing basic maintenance.
    • Skills were typically acquired through on-the-job training and experience.
  • Technological Advancements:

    • The introduction of automated systems and computerized controls led to a greater emphasis on technical knowledge and problem-solving skills.
    • Operators began to use sophisticated monitoring equipment and diagnostic tools.
  • Modern Era:

    • Today, operators are often responsible for managing entire production lines or complex industrial processes.
    • They must be proficient in using computer-based control systems, analyzing data, and troubleshooting complex problems.
    • The focus has shifted towards optimizing efficiency, ensuring safety, and minimizing environmental impact.

In India, the evolution of operator roles has been driven by the country's industrial growth and adoption of advanced technologies. As India continues to modernize its industries, the demand for highly skilled and adaptable operators will continue to grow.
